Industrial Metal Component Landscape in Ireland

Analyzing the intersection of maritime climate and heavy-duty tool requirements.

Ireland's manufacturing sector, particularly in the west and south, faces unique challenges due to its high humidity and saline coastal air. This environment accelerates the corrosion of traditional truck brake drums, demanding advanced surface treatments and high-grade alloy compositions to ensure long-term operational safety.

The logistics hubs in Dublin and Cork rely heavily on efficient material handling. The demand for a robust lifting platform power unit has surged as warehouses transition to automated vertical storage, requiring components that can handle erratic load cycles without hydraulic failure.

Furthermore, the agricultural machinery market in rural Ireland necessitates heavy-duty components like semi brake drums that can withstand mud, grit, and varying thermal loads, pushing the industry toward more resilient, precision-cast metal tools.

Market Development History

In the early 2000s, the Irish market relied primarily on standardized cast iron components. The primary focus was on bulk availability rather than precision, leading to higher wear rates in brake drum assemblies used in regional transport.

Between 2010 and 2020, there was a significant shift toward CNC machining and heat-treatment optimization. This era saw the introduction of high-pressure seals and alloy reinforcements in hydraulic systems, drastically reducing the downtime for heavy machinery.

Today, the industry has entered the era of "Smart Metallurgy," where components are designed using finite element analysis (FEA) to optimize weight-to-strength ratios, ensuring that every part meets strict EU safety and environmental regulations.

Industrial FAQ for the Irish Market

Technical answers to common metal tool and hydraulic queries.

How do I choose the right truck brake drums for coastal regions?

For coastal regions like Galway or Cork, we recommend drums with anti-corrosion coatings and high-carbon alloy to prevent surface pitting and oxidation.

What is the lifespan of a lifting platform power unit in high-cycle warehouses?

Our units are designed for 10,000+ cycles before requiring seal maintenance, provided the hydraulic fluid is replaced according to schedule.

Are hsg hydraulic cylinders compatible with standard EU fittings?

Yes, all our cylinders are manufactured to meet ISO and European DIN standards for seamless integration into existing machinery.

What is the difference between semi brake drums and full drums?

Semi brake drums are designed for specific modular axle configurations, offering easier replacement and specialized heat dissipation for medium-load vehicles.

How to prevent overheating in heavy-duty brake drum systems?

We utilize vented casting designs and high-thermal-conductivity materials to ensure heat is dissipated rapidly during prolonged braking.

What maintenance is required for hydraulic power units in cold weather?

During Irish winters, we recommend using low-viscosity hydraulic oils and ensuring that heaters are installed on the tank to maintain fluid flow.
